mysqldump
命令导出数据库。基本语法是:,“sh,mysqldump u 用户名 p密码 数据库名 > 导出的文件.sql,
`,,
`sh,mysqldump u root p123456 mydatabase > mydatabase_backup.sql,
“ MySQL数据库的导出操作对于数据备份、迁移或恢复等任务至关重要,以下是一些常见的方法来导出MySQL数据库:
1、导出整个数据库:要导出一个名为example_db的整个数据库,可以使用以下命令:
mysqldump u root p example_db > example_db.sql
这条命令将数据库example_db的数据和结构导出到example_db.sql文件中。
2、导出所有数据库:如果要导出MySQL服务器上的所有数据库,可以执行如下命令:
mysqldump u root p alldatabases > all_databases.sql
这将把所有数据库的数据和结构导出到all_databases.sql文件中。
3、导出特定数据库中的特定表:如果只需要导出特定数据库中的某些表,例如db1数据库中的a1和a2表,可以使用以下命令:
mysqldump u root p databases db1 tables a1 a2 > db1_tables.sql
这会将db1数据库中的a1和a2表导出到db1_tables.sql文件中。
4、条件导出:在某些情况下,可能只需要导出满足特定条件的表数据,只导出db1数据库中a1表id为1的数据:
mysqldump u root p databases db1 tables a1 where='id=1' > conditional_data.sql
这样可以得到一个仅包含符合条件的数据的SQL文件。
使用图形化界面工具
除了命令行工具外,还可以使用图形化界面工具如phpMyAdmin进行数据库的导入和导出,这些工具通常提供直观的操作界面,使得非技术用户也能轻松管理数据库。
提供了在MySQL中导出数据库的多种方法,包括使用命令行工具和图形化界面工具,每种方法都有其适用场景和优势,用户可以根据自己的需求和技术水平选择合适的方法。
步骤 | 说明 | 操作命令 |
1 | 确保你有足够的权限来导出数据库。 | 通常需要数据库的root用户权限。 |
2 | 登录MySQL服务器。 | 使用命令行或图形界面工具登录MySQL。 |
3 | 选择要导出的数据库。 | 使用USE 语句切换到目标数据库。 |
4 | 使用mysqldump 工具导出数据库。 | mysqldump 是MySQL自带的导出工具。 |
5 | 指定导出文件的存储位置和文件名。 | 使用p 参数添加密码,u 参数指定用户,h 参数指定主机(如果需要)。 |
6 | 执行导出命令。 | 使用命令行执行mysqldump 命令。 |
7 | 检查导出的文件。 | 确保文件已成功导出,并且包含所有必要的数据库结构和数据。 |
以下是一个具体的命令行示例:
登录MySQL mysql u your_username p 选择数据库 USE your_database; 导出数据库 mysqldump u your_username p your_database > your_database_backup.sql 退出MySQL EXIT;
请将your_username
和your_database
替换为你的MySQL用户名和数据库名称,如果需要导出多个数据库,可以重复上述命令,只需更改数据库名称即可。
最新评论
本站CDN与莫名CDN同款、亚太CDN、速度还不错,值得推荐。
感谢推荐我们公司产品、有什么活动会第一时间公布!
我在用这类站群服务器、还可以. 用很多年了。